Transaction 7080dc3eba66f705b1a121aff07402c16ec15975492170f42d329e338dd3c92a
1 Input
1 Output
-
7080dc3eba66f705b1a121aff07402c16ec15975492170f42d329e338dd3c92a:0
- value
- 18337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3eda3061f2ff6696d4db551273a9a9199379969d OP_EQUAL
- address
- 37RMCUTzQ4HyMm5oAv57MduWziATVXbfEQ